Solution

The correct option is D Allopatric
Allopatric speciation is the process of speciation which takes place due to geographical isolation of individuals.
Sympatric speciation is the process of speciation which takes place due to reproductive isolation of species inhabiting same area.
Parapetric speciation is the one which leads to the formation of new species due to extreme change in habitat.
Sibling species are those which are morphologically identical and capable of producing fertile offsprings.
Thus, the correct answer is option D.
